Truelogic is a leading provider of nearshore staff augmentation services, located in New York. Our team of 500 tech talents is driving digital disruption from Latin America to the top projects in U.S. companies. Truelogic has been helping companies of all sizes to achieve their digital transformation goals.

What are you going to do?

You will have the opportunity to work in a forward-thinking and growth-oriented environment, at a top American mortgage lender with over 4 million lifetime customers

Occupy a unique position in the market, responsible for providing strategic guidance, designs, and solution patterns to team members. Serve as a driver and collaborator throughout development life cycle, partnering with business analysts and customers to review and optimize requirements; and, working with developers to review and validate key functionality and integration. Responsible for ensuring feasibility of design and integration with existing systems/platforms.

  • Capable of owning technical design for projects of moderate complexity, and understands the tradeoffs in creating good software

  • Understand the capabilities and limitation of existing software and demonstrate a preference to extend, re-use and integrate with them effectively while also improving them

  • Make reasonable design tradeoffs between short term results and building for the long term

  • Understand and actively participate in team's scrum activities and rituals as well as help others to understand and embrace them

  • Provide technical leadership and guidance to more junior engineers

 

What will help you succeed

  • Extensive experience working with Python and modern web frameworks (e.g. Fast API, Flask, Django)

  • Experience with queueing systems (Celery, SQS, Pub/Sub, etc)

  • Strong Experience with REST APIs

  • Strong Experience Writing Unit Tests

  • Experience with Event Driven Systems & Microservices

  • Experience with Amazon Web Services (AWS) and serverless

  • Experience with Infrastructure as Code (Cloudformation & CDK)

  • Knowledge of Databases (SQL, NoSQL)

  • Knowledge of DevOps Practices (CI/CD, Automated Pipelines)

  • Experience with Agile, Scrum, Jira

  • Demonstrated ability to master at least one major skill outside of core coding such as monitoring, documentation, security, integration testing, visual design, devops, performance optimization

  • Demonstrated track record of creating significant improvements across business-critical product ecosystems around stability, security, performance, and scalability

  • Demonstrated ability to understand, facilitate or actively participate in multi team or multi subproduct scrum activities and rituals, help others to understand them

  • Demonstrated ability to effectively convey complex technical topics in ways that that could be easily understood by engineers, POs, PMs or nontechnical colleagues

  • Able to collaborate across teams and build systems to address architectural gaps

  • Capable of leading small to mid-size epic level efforts

  • Financial Services and, if possible, mortgage industry experience preferred

  • Strong business acumen and ability to interface with executive management

Must have

  • Degree in computer science, engineering or similar major

  • 5 years of experience with software development

  • Deep understanding of and experience with modern python (3.x)

  • SQL (stored procedures, preferably with Snowflake)

  • Python frameworks (e.g. Fast API/Flask/Django) - 1 or more

  • Queueing systems (Celery, SQS, Pub/Sub, etc)
